Epilepsy and Autism

Its been a while since I visit my blog,, maybe because there is nothing to write and also everything about my daughter is the same,,, everything is good and she's doing great. Last year, Nov. 7 to be exact my husband found our Michaella lying on the floor wiggling, her eyes looking upwards, the body is very stiff and her lip color was blue,,, Ella! Ella! but no response. God! we panicked we had no idea what was happening. We took her to a hospital, as soon as we arrived she was already concious and as if nothing happen and the first thing she asked was her slippers and wanted to go home. She was confined for 2 days, after that she had an EEG and the result was normal, the Nuerologist told us we wait for the 2nd attack that is beacause epilepsy could attack once a year or once in 5 yrs. so we should start the medication if the attack should ever happen again.
Last thursday, Feb. 12 she had her 2nd attack, she was in school. Now, she is on medication she's taking Tegretol 200 mg twice daily for 1 week, 1 1/2 tablets twice daily for the follwing weeks then another check up to see if she's doing ok with the meds and she will take Tegretol for 2 years hopefully this will cure her epilepsy. This is so frustrating, as I have said on my past posts she improves beyond my expectations. Epilepsy, a new chapter of my life.
Dra. Fojas of Makati Medical Center a Pediatric Neurologist expalined, epilepsy and autism as I have remembered is like a partner, I really thought it only occur on little ones but she said it also occur on early teens and early adulthood especially with autistics. The good news about it, is, it can be cured! Hopefully Tegretol can take this away.
